Как избавиться от mfpmp.exe и от “тормозов” при воспроизведении в Windows Media Player 11

На днях уже не первый раз столкнулся с такой ситуацией: при воспроизведении музыки (большого файла – длительностью более часа) с помощью Windows Media Player 11 на Vista компьютер временами вдруг начинал очень тормозить – звук даже начинал “заикаться”.

В диспетчере задач обнаружился и виновник сего безобразия – программка mfpmp.exe размером всего 24 килобайта, но занимающая несколько мегабайт в памяти и загружающая процессор на 9-30%. Порывшись в интернете, я выяснил, что эта программа – Media Foundation Protected Media Pipeline, часть Windows Vista DRM. Самое интересное в том, что она запускается и работает одновременно с WMP11, а не только во время воспроизведения ним DRM-защищённого контента.

Решений в интернете нашлось всего два:

  1. Не использовать WMP11.
  2. Переименовать файл, чтобы Vista не смогла его запускать (да-да, удалять не рекомендуют, лучше – переименовать или переместить).

Внимание! Важное исправление! Решение отключить mfpmp.exe — неправильное! Если у вас не стоят сторонние кодеки, то WMP перестанет воспроизводить форматы WMA и WMV, даже обычные, не защищённые DRM! Поэтому вместо отключения компоненты попробуйте обновить драйвера звуковой карты, у меня это решило проблему.

Так как первый вариант мне не подходит (по крайней мере, в данный момент), и DRM-контента у меня нет – решил переименовать файл. Но оказалось – это не так-то просто: в Vista даже обладая правами администратора (!), переименовать файл (он находится в папке C:\Windows\System32) было невозможно! Причина оказалась простой: у администратора не было прав на удаление файла, а добавить себе прав он не мог, т.к. не являлся владельцем данного файла. Таким образом, чтобы удалить такой вот системный файл, надо:

  1. Вызывать окно свойств файла.
  2. На вкладке “Безопасность” нажать кнопку “Дополнительно”.
  3. В появившемся окне выбрать вкладку “Владелец” и изменить владельца – выбрать учётную запись администратора или группу администраторов, подтвердить и полностью закрыть окно свойств файла (это важно!).
  4. Снова вызывать окно свойств файла.
  5. Изменить права доступа и закрыть окно свойств файла.
  6. Переименовать файл (наконец-то!).

Напоминаю: делать всё это нужно очень осторожно, и только если у вас нет контента, защищённого DRM.


Желаете отблагодарить автора? Есть несколько возможностей! :-)
Яндекс.Деньги:   PayPal:
Прочие варианты:


8 комментариев на “Как избавиться от mfpmp.exe и от “тормозов” при воспроизведении в Windows Media Player 11”

  1. Алексей Optimistus Чернов Says:

    Первая приходящая мысль — какое шаманство! А почему ты привязан к WMP11? (ой чую вызовет это холивар 🙂

  2. BlackBird Says:

    Когда-то пользовался WinAmp, потом AIMP и foobar2000, в конце концов перешёл на WMP11, потому что: 1) В нём есть SRS WOW: http://blog.trufanov.com/2007/09/06/wow-nemnogo-pro-windows-media-player/ 2) Привык уже к библиотеке и быстрому поиску по ней 3) Удобно заливать подкасты и аудиокниги на мобилу

  3. Антон Карев Says:

    По поводу подкастов: они добавляются по RSS? Кстати, некоторые файлы flv, mkv в WMP не поддерживают перемотку, установлен набор кодеков CCCP. Может знаете решение?

  4. BlackBird Says:

    Антон Карев, у меня самое большое нарекание по поводу WMP11 — это то, что он не умеет работать с подкастами, т.е. не умеет их автоматически получать. Это удивительно ещё и потому что в Vista есть целое API или вроде того (типа на уровне операционки) для работы с RSS, но WMP11 о подкастах «ничего не знает» (в отличие от iTunes). Так что приходится пользоваться сторонним софтом. Неплохой обзор — тут: http://www.podcastim.ru/2008/05/podkast-klienty-dlya-windows/ однако из всего перечисленного нормальные лишь Doppler (только качайте с сайта CTP-версию!) и Juice. iTunes я не ставил — на медиатеке нормального размера (по нынешним временам — не большого, а просто нормального) он жутко тормозит, и при воспроизведении сильно грузит машину. По поводу mkv и flv — не подскажу, у самого с flv та же ситуация (mkv нет — так что не могу проверить), хоть стоит K-Lite Mega Codec Pack.

  5. Классности Windows Media Player 11 Says:

    […] Нагрузку на процессор я уменьшил, отключив mfpmp.exe. После установки K-Lite Mega Codec Pack плейер играет все форматы: и OGG, и APE, и другие. […]

  6. wisp Says:

    кстати о mfpmp.exe,как то неоднозначно http://www.thevista.ru/page.php?id=9079&print=1

  7. BlackBird Says:

    wisp, а что там неоднозначного? 🙂 То что Гутманн ничего не замерял сам? Ну так я и без него «замерил» — разница в нагрузке на проц ощутима 🙂

  8. tiaurus+ | Сокращаем вахтера Windows Vista | Срываем тормоза WMP | tiaurus.ru Says:

    […] том же блоге я нашел и элегантную отмычку от дверей тормознутости Windows Media […]